White Sox first baseman Paul Konerko doesn't need any reminders that his days in the majors are dwindling -- quickly. His body has plenty of baseball mileage, making it much harder to get through a full season without injury. And so, as he readies himself for his 15th season with Chicago, Konerko said he hasn't made any decisions beyond 2013. "Its going to happen," Konerko told reporters Sunday. "All my tight friends that I played with coming up are out of the game. I see what the other side is and there are pluses and minuses to that. I pick their brains on it. But you got to prepare. ... Im not afraid of that. Im not scared of it. I just want to go as hard as I can until it happens."
